Algumas teclas do meu teclado estão quebradas. LXDE/Openbox. É possível criar atalhos de caixa aberta que produzam a chave correspondente globalmente?

Algumas teclas do meu teclado estão quebradas. LXDE/Openbox. É possível criar atalhos de caixa aberta que produzam a chave correspondente globalmente?

Algumas teclas do meu teclado estão quebradas. Estou usando LXDE/Openbox. É possível criar atalhos de caixa aberta que produzam a chave correspondente globalmente?

Olá,

Os números cinco e seis não estão funcionando no meu teclado.

Estou usando LXDE/Openbox.

É possível criar um atalho, por exemplo Alt mais F, que sempre produza o número cinco globalmente, independentemente do aplicativo que estou usando, mesmo que seja o navegador ou qualquer outra coisa?

Vesa

Responder1

Eu faço algo semelhante na minha máquina. Eu tenho um Chromebook que possui uma tecla backspace, mas não uma tecla delete. Usando os atalhos de teclado do LXDE, mapeei alt-backspace para excluir. Isto exigexdotool.

Dê uma olhada em ~/.config/openbox/lxde-rc.xml. Procure por "keybind" e entenda a sintaxe. Aqui está um pedaço do meu lxde-rc.xml para meu mapeamento:

<keybind key="A-BackSpace">
  <action name="Execute">
    <startupnotify>
      <enabled>true</enabled>
      <name>Delete</name>
    </startupnotify>
    <command>xdotool key --clearmodifiers Delete</command>
  </action>
</keybind>

Essa combinação de teclas funciona em qualquer lugar da sessão do LXDE.

informação relacionada